Starting in the hawk's early life, it is fed by its parents until it leaves the nest. The young hawk, while still in its fledgling phase, will leave its nest as early as six weeks old. Once the bird is older it begins to hunt. The hawk kills its prey with its talons as opposed to other predator birds, such as the falcon. WebMar 17, 2024 · The Hawk Hawks are raptor birds, which fall into the same category as eagles, owls, falcons, kites, and even vultures. The raptor is also known as a bird of prey, which means it pursues and hunts other animals for food. We will focus on the red-tailed hawk as they are the most common hawks in North America.
